Transaction db5334123ede8a99017775592b845e93923cde40a9e3c5cd4e2daf51bf8de917
1 Input
1 Output
-
db5334123ede8a99017775592b845e93923cde40a9e3c5cd4e2daf51bf8de917:0
- value
- 605591
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 b6585c027873d86c6fedca279c88d10a8399d697 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Hd9qEW1HRM1skR5Kn5yWbroZdiUNCxhFw